Android开发之SeekBar点击thumb | 按下thumb | 按住thumb | 滑动thumb导致周围出现圆形阴影 | 灰色阴影的解决办法 | 点击SeekBar外部出现圆形阴影

老套路先上图:这是原生的SeekBar点击的效果

Android开发之SeekBar点击thumb | 按下thumb | 按住thumb | 滑动thumb导致周围出现圆形阴影 | 灰色阴影的解决办法 | 点击SeekBar外部出现圆形阴影_第1张图片

 再看看自定义SeekBar电机的效果

Android开发之SeekBar点击thumb | 按下thumb | 按住thumb | 滑动thumb导致周围出现圆形阴影 | 灰色阴影的解决办法 | 点击SeekBar外部出现圆形阴影_第2张图片

 解决办法:

非常简单,真让人不敢相信直接设置SeekBar的背景为null或者透明色即可

Android开发之SeekBar点击thumb | 按下thumb | 按住thumb | 滑动thumb导致周围出现圆形阴影 | 灰色阴影的解决办法 | 点击SeekBar外部出现圆形阴影_第3张图片

 Android开发之SeekBar点击thumb | 按下thumb | 按住thumb | 滑动thumb导致周围出现圆形阴影 | 灰色阴影的解决办法 | 点击SeekBar外部出现圆形阴影_第4张图片

代码如下:

 
  

非常感谢原博主:博主直达

再看下android原生的seekbar如果不设置thumb,然后点击seekbar以外的地方看看效果

Android开发之SeekBar点击thumb | 按下thumb | 按住thumb | 滑动thumb导致周围出现圆形阴影 | 灰色阴影的解决办法 | 点击SeekBar外部出现圆形阴影_第5张图片

 效果非常吓人,所以我们再设置背景为null再次点击就没有上面这个效果了,设置背景确实可用

你可能感兴趣的:(Android技巧,点击seekbar外部出现阴影,点击seekbar圆形阴影,按住seekbar圆形阴影,滑动seekbar圆形阴影,安卓按下thumb圆形阴影)